In 2010, I was diagnosed with Large Diffuse B-cell Lymphoma. I was 25 and a newly wed. I went through six rounds of Hyper CVAD chemotherapy and in 2011, I was declared to be in remission.
I fought to find myself and to figure out what that means. I survived chemo and the physical and mental side effects and found that my fiber artistry is the key to my well being. I've now brought that to you with my handmade organs.
The whole idea behind Survival Organs is that we're all equipped with the stuff we need to survive life and the crazy stuff that comes in. It just takes some digging and self care to find where we put them. My lymph nodes are just an external reminder that we've got that "right stuff". And that's what I learned from chemo. You do have the "guts" face something huge like cancer.
